Course Overview:

This course is designed to help underemployed professionals strengthen essential corporate skills required in today’s workplace.
It focuses on communication, professionalism, teamwork, problem-solving, and workplace expectations.
The session bridges the gap between academic knowledge and real corporate requirements.
Practical examples and guided activities help build confidence, clarity, and job readiness within one day.

Learning Objectives:

• Understand corporate workplace expectations
• Improve professional communication skills
• Develop teamwork and collaboration abilities
• Strengthen problem-solving and adaptability
• Improve time management and discipline
• Build workplace confidence and readiness
• Increase employability and career preparedness

Agenda
Module 1: Understanding Underemployment & Corporate Expectations

Info:
• Understand underemployment and its impact on career growth
• Identify gaps between current roles and corporate expectations
• Recognize how employers assess readiness beyond qualifications
• Icebreaker


Module 2: Core Corporate Communication Skills

Info:
• Communicate clearly in emails, meetings, and daily interactions
• Use professional tone, structure, and workplace language
• Avoid common communication mistakes that limit growth
• Activity


Module 3: Workplace Professionalism & Reliability

Info:
• Demonstrate professionalism through behavior and attitude
• Understand accountability, ownership, and work ethics
• Build trust and credibility in the workplace
• Case Study


Module 4: Collaboration, Team Dynamics & Workplace Fit

Info:
• Work effectively with teams and managers
• Understand team roles and collaboration expectations
• Handle feedback and disagreements constructively
• Simulation


Module 5: Problem-Solving & Value Creation at Work

Info:
• Approach workplace problems with structured thinking
• Move from task execution to value contribution
• Show initiative and solution-oriented mindset
• Role Play


Module 6: Time Management, Productivity & Work Discipline

Info:
• Manage workload and deadlines effectively
• Prioritize tasks in fast-paced work environments
• Improve focus, accuracy, and consistency
• Activity


Module 7: Career Readiness & Transition to Better Roles

Info:
• Position skills for higher-value and stable roles
• Understand expectations for growth, promotion, and role change
• Build confidence for interviews and performance reviews
• Case Study
